Simple Picture or Book Rails - Mikes Inventions
zhlédnutí 227Před rokem
mikesinventions.etsy.com Simple Picture or Book Rails shows you how I took some cheap MDF and made some nice shiny white picture rails that can also be used for books! The 1/2" MDF strips were cut 2.5, 2.5, and 1.5" wide then glued together with Titebond 3 wood glue. They didn't require any doweling because of their size, which simplifies the build immensely.     I did this mod on what I can tell exactly the same UPS. One word of wisdom to share- do not put much load on it without also doing a fan mod. Mine overheated after around an hour, shut off and never worked again. I did not place more load on it than it was rated for, but I think the assumption by their engineers is that the duty cycle will be limited due to the limited duration of the included batteries.
